Restoration Summer

By Kimberly Kirkland Absher

Description:

She knows how to restore houses.
He’s the only one who’s ever made her want to restore her heart.

Vivian Mills knows how to restore anything except the life she lost.

Once the face of a hit design show, Vivian built her career transforming broken spaces into something beautiful. But behind the success was a life quietly unraveling: a marriage that ended in betrayal, a future that slipped out of reach, and a loss she’s never been able to put into words.

Now, a high-profile renovation in the Hamptons is her chance to start over. Keep things simple. Keep things controlled. And above all… don’t get attached.

Until Ethan Cross.

They met once before, in a place meant for people learning how to live with what they couldn’t fix. Back then, keeping her distance was easy. Now, working side by side on a house that feels a little too much like her own heart, it’s anything but.

Ethan is steady in all the ways she isn’t. Patient. Unshaken. The kind of man who sees straight through her defenses and stays anyway. He doesn’t rush her. Doesn’t try to fix what’s broken. But somehow, he makes her want things she swore she’d buried for good.

As the summer unfolds and the house begins to come back to life, so does something inside Vivian she’s spent years trying to silence. But opening her heart again means facing the truth about everything she’s lost. And risking a kind of love she’s not sure she can survive twice.

Because the hardest thing she’ll ever have to rebuild…
is the part of herself that still dares to want him.

Restoration Summer is a deeply emotional story about grief, second chances, and the quiet, powerful way love asks us to be brave again.

Why the author wrote this book:

Vivian and Ethan were first sketched out in my Laurel Springs novella series, but their story didn’t fit. The more I tried to shape it, the more it became clear they needed something deeper and more layered. That’s when I knew they belonged in the Seasons of the Heart series.

While drafting When Spring Blooms, I found the right place to introduce them. Vivian is a guarded, deeply layered character, and Ethan is the kind of steady, patient man who doesn’t walk away when things get hard.

Ethan’s military background led me to the U.S. Navy, inspired in part by the Korean War stories my dad shared with me growing up. That connection became even more meaningful when I wove in the discovery of love letters between his aunt and uncle written aboard the USS Twining, the same ship my dad served on during the war.

As Vivian’s story unfolded, I realized her guarded heart had to come from a place of deep loss. From there, Restoration Summer took shape as a story about grief, healing, and the courage to love again.
